Emergency Siding Tarping in Des Peres, MO

When wind-driven hail or a fallen limb rips a panel off a Des Peres home mid-storm, the sheathing behind that gap starts drinking water within minutes and moisture creeps into the framing. Emergency siding tarping in Des Peres, MO is the stopgap that buys you the days you need before permanent siding repair work can begin. Top Quality Exteriors dispatches crews after wind and hail events so exposed walls, torn house wrap, and missing panels are sealed off before rain, humidity, or hidden insulation damage compound behind the wall.

Our emergency siding tarping process uses commercial-grade tarps, house wrap, cap nails, and furring strips to create a wind- and water-tight seal across missing panels — the same system we use for emergency roof tarping. On homes in the 1970s Dougherty Woods and Four Winds Farm subdivisions where original hardboard siding tends to shatter under limb strikes, we anchor to sound framing without punching new holes in surrounding good siding. Once the tarp is set, we photograph the damage, then schedule a quote for storm damage siding repair or replacement.

Why Rapid Tarping Matters Here

Des Peres sits inside the West County band that took the brunt of the May 16, 2025 EF3 tornado, and West County storm history stretches back to the April 24, 2010 tornado that touched down here directly. St. Louis sits in one of the most active hail corridors in the country, averaging three to five significant hail events per year — a stat that plays out on the ground as torn panels, punctured house wrap, and blown-out J-channel. When the emergency line rings after a hail-and-wind event, the clock is already running. Rain infiltrates within hours through even a small gap in the weather barrier; overnight humidity soaks the OSB or plywood sheathing; and insulation batts wick moisture into the cavity where drywall and framing pay the price. Tarping is not the fix — it is the pause button that keeps the interior dry while you line up permanent siding repair work. Our crews strap in cap-nailed tarps, house wrap patches, and furring strips that can hold through the next storm cell without becoming projectiles themselves.

Our 5-Step Tarping Process

When the emergency line rings, we don’t leave you guessing. Here’s how our crews move from your first call to a fully weatherproofed exterior — five stages designed to protect your home now and set up the permanent siding fix later.

24/7 Dispatch

You call the 24/7 emergency line and reach a real person, not a machine. We log the address, damage type, and current weather window. A crew heads out to your Des Peres property.

Onsite Response

Our crew arrives in marked trucks with tarps, wrap, and fasteners. We walk the exterior together to confirm every breach. Then we mark priority tarping zones and stage materials.

Weatherproofing

We wrap the exposed sheathing, then anchor tarp with cap nails and furring strips. Seams are lapped and taped for wind-driven rain. This seal holds through the next storm cell.

Damage Photos

We photograph every breach, tarp point, and interior water sign. The photo set gives your carrier what it needs to open a claim. You keep every image before we leave the driveway.

Follow-Up Quote

Within days we return with a written quote for the permanent fix. Options include patch repair, full re-clad, or whole-house replacement. We book the crew as soon as you approve.

What Emergency Tarping Costs

Emergency siding tarping in Des Peres runs on a small-scope pricing model — most single-breach jobs land in the low hundreds for materials and labor, and a whole-side tarp on a larger custom home climbs higher based on square footage and access. What you’re paying for is the crew time, the cap-nail and furring anchor system, and the photo documentation that follows. Ballpark numbers should always be confirmed after an in-person walk-through of the damage.

Insurance often covers emergency tarping as part of the storm-loss claim, though your out-of-pocket depends on your deductible and RCV/ACV terms. In Missouri most homeowner policies give twelve months to file a hail or wind claim — the point is tarping does not have to be paid upfront if you have coverage. When it’s installed correctly, yes. A cap-nailed tarp over synthetic house wrap and exposed sheathing creates a wind- and water-tight seal that survives normal rain, wind, and overnight humidity. What tarping cannot do is undo damage already inside the wall when we arrived — if insulation is wet or drywall is stained, it becomes part of the permanent repair scope.
Temporary emergency weatherproofing generally does not require its own permit — it is not a structural or permanent repair. The permanent siding repair or replacement that follows may need a Des Peres building permit through the city’s Building Division, and the local HOA in your subdivision may review material and color choices. In most cases, yes. Missouri policies commonly treat temporary weatherproofing as a reasonable step to prevent further loss, and that cost is folded into your storm claim scope alongside the permanent siding work. Your deductible and RCV versus ACV terms still apply, so review your declarations page before the adjuster visit. Save receipts and every photo — those documents shape what gets paid.
